LA Nails has recently undergone a massive renovation in Eastgate mall. They bought the store beside them and expanded the space to accommodate a larger number of people, hired additional staff to cater to those extra numbers, added a massage and waxing area, and a nicer restroom. Equipment is all new, from what I can tell, and pedi chairs are all updated. They’ve added a children’s area of pedi chairs, as well. That being said, it is a mall salon. You will not be escorted to a quiet spa room in the back, like at Mitchells or Avalon. However, the prices are on par with a mall joint, and you do not need an appointment-pretty much ever. I will also say that my polish lasts forever when I got here– this is the best experience that I’ve had with Shellac manicures with these«drop-by» kind of establishments. Want a spa experience? Upgrade to a salon. Want a drive-by mani/pedi at the last moment? Def worth the stop.
